The 6008 ZZ bearing is a prominent component in various machinery and automotive applications, known for its excellent performance and robust design. This bearing is classified as a deep groove ball bearing, which makes it suitable for high-speed operation and capable of withstanding considerable radial and axial loads. Understanding its dimensions and specifications is crucial for those in mechanical engineering, manufacturing, and maintenance sectors.
The dimensions of the 6008 ZZ bearing are as follows it typically has an inner diameter of 40 mm, an outer diameter of 68 mm, and a width of 15 mm. These measurements make it suitable for a wide range of applications, from electric motors to agricultural machinery. The 'ZZ' designation refers to the presence of metal shields on both sides of the bearing, which helps to prevent the ingress of dust and contaminants, thereby extending the bearing's lifespan and reliability.
Installation and maintenance of the 6008 ZZ bearing are straightforward, but it is important to ensure that it is properly lubricated. Most bearings come pre-lubricated, but periodic checks are necessary, especially in applications that involve high speeds or heavy loads. Using the right type of lubricant can significantly enhance the bearing's life and performance.
In terms of performance, the 6008 ZZ bearing is known for its low friction and high efficiency. These characteristics make it an ideal choice for applications that require smooth and continuous motion. Moreover, its simple yet effective design allows for easy replacement and maintenance, which is important in industrial settings where machine uptime is critical.
